Frequently Asked Questions about apartment rentals in Brighton, Australia

  • What is Brighton, Australia famous for?

    Brighton, Australia is best known for its stunning beach, particularly the iconic Brighton Beach Boxes. These colorful bathing boxes are a unique and instantly recognizable landmark, attracting many visitors. The area also boasts a vibrant bayside atmosphere, with great restaurants and cafes.

  • When should you visit Brighton, Australia for the best experience?

    Brighton enjoys a pleasant Mediterranean climate. The best time to visit is during the spring (September-November) and autumn (March-May) for comfortable temperatures and fewer crowds. Summer (December-February) is warm, but can be very busy. Winter (June-August) is mild, but some businesses may have reduced hours.

  • What sports or recreational activities are a big draw in Brighton, Australia?

    Brighton's beach is perfect for swimming, sunbathing, and surfing. Walking and cycling along the bayside paths are popular. Nearby, you can find opportunities for sailing and other watersports. The area also has excellent facilities for running and other fitness activities.

  • What are the top sights to visit in Brighton, Australia?

    The Brighton Beach Boxes are the most iconic sight. Take a stroll along Brighton Beach, enjoying the views. Explore the shops and cafes along Bay Street. Consider a visit to the nearby St Kilda pier and its penguin colony for a different perspective of the coastline.
